Security cautions

When using this product, take appropriate measures to avoid the following security
breaches.

L

Leaks of private information via this product

L

Illegal use of this product by a third party

L

Interference or suspension of the use of this product by a third party

Take the following measures to avoid security breaches:

L

To prevent illegal access, keep the update firmware (If you do not have the latest version
of firmware, this can lead to blocked access or information leaks).

L

When downloading data from the Internet, ensure that viruses or illegal programs are
not inadvertently downloaded.

L

You are responsible for the security settings, such as user name and password, to
access this product. This information is transferred in plain text format between the base
unit and your computer. This information should not be made available to any third
parties outside the user group.

L

Place this product where it is unlikely to be stolen.

L

You are responsible for this product’s user information, such as contact list, Internet
settings etc. This information should not be made available to any third parties outside
the user group.

L

You are responsible for keeping a record of the user name and password used for the
PPPoE connection. Depending on the Internet service provider you use, the user name
and password for the PPPoE connection may be transferred in plain text format.

L

You are responsible for using No Encryption mode for the wireless security setting,
since there is a risk of sent/received data being intercepted by a third party.

L

When sending this product to be repaired with a company not related to Panasonic,
make a back-up file of the base unit settings, if necessary, and reset this product to
factory default.

L

When transferring this product to another party, make a back-up file of the base unit
settings, if necessary, and reset this product to factory default.

L

When disposing of this product, reset this product to factory default, or erase information
by means of electrical deletion or physical dismantlement.
